About The Position

The Patman Center for Civic and Political Engagement at the LBJ School of Public Affairs seeks a full-time Administrative Program Coordinator to support center-related activities, courses, and events. The Patman Center's mission is to strengthen our democracy by cultivating skilled leaders who exemplify an ethos of civility, service, and bipartisanship. The Center achieves this mission by providing students with extensive leadership training in a bipartisan environment, a working knowledge of our democratic government and opportunities for experiential learning, internships, and political mentoring.
